With the continuous deepening of China's democratic political process and the popularity and development of the Internet,The Internet has increasingly become the main channel for people to express their ideas,appeal for interests,and participate in public policy making.More and more citizens are actively involved in the specific affairs of public policy formulation in various countries.Citizens can support and exert pressure on the government system by participating in the formulation of national public policies.On the one hand,they can put the will of citizens in the public policy of the country.It is reflected in the management activities,on the other hand,it can also provide legitimacy for public policy formulation,thus ensuring the effective operation of the government management system.For developing countries,citizen participation is of particular importance because the wide participation of citizens in national affairs is both a sign of the level of political development in these countries and a driving force for their continued democratization.the participation of citizen networks in the formulation of public policies has become increasingly active,and it has also brought extensive attention and research to this new type of political participation behavior.In this paper,the relevant research results of academic circles in recent years are reviewed and commented on the characteristics,status quo,problems and countermeasures of citizen network participation in public policy formulation,in order to further promote the research of citizen network participation in public policy formulation.As a new form of participation,public network participation has the advantage that public participation can't match in the traditional government environment,which has injected new vitality and vitality into the public participation.The emergence and development of the Internet has completely broken the geographical restrictions and time and space restrictions of information transmission,and provided a new form for citizens to participate in public policy formulation.However,we must realize that although the Internet provides a broader platform for citizens to participate in citizen policy formulation,since this form of citizen participation is still in the development stage in China,it will inevitably bring some negative effects.Of course,the Internet has brought us the gospel and brought many challenges.For example,the irrationality of the participation of the public network,the lack of normativeness,and the emergence of the "digital divide" have promoted new unfairness.Ensuring that citizens participate in the public policy of science and democracy through the Internet,making it more in line with the interests of the people Therefore,how to use opportunities,respond to challenges,and promote the orderly and benign development of public network policy participation has become an essential part of the research in the Internet environment.Firstly,based on the related concepts and theories of public participation in public policy formulation in the Internet environment,the third chapter briefly summarizes the specific ways of China's current citizen network participation in politics,and analyzes the characteristics and current situation of network participation in politics.Secondly,aiming at the status quo of public participation in the process of public policy formulation under the Internet environment,combined with relevant cases,analyzes the shortcomings of public network participation in all aspects of public policy formulation.The fourth chapter discusses the current citizens from different angles.The network participates in the problems of public policy formulation and analyzes the causes based on the problems.The fifth chapter is based on the experience of civic network participation in foreign countries such as the United States,Canada and South Korea.This leads to the sixth chapter,the last part,combined with the excellent experience of domestic and international development,and proposes corresponding rationalization measures for existing problems to regulate the public.Public participation in the policy development process.With the help of the "Internet" platform,we should give full play to the advantages of the public's participation in public policy formulation through the network,and at the same time limit the negative impact of network participation from different levels such as system,law,government,and public,and further explore how the public can effectively work in the network environment.Participate in policy development.
